The Red Arrows Perform Their First Public Aerobatic Display


    The Royal Air Force Red Arrows perform their first public aerobatic display since the tragic death of Flt Lt Jon Egging on September 2, 2011 in Chatsworth, England. The Red Arrows dedictated the display at Chatsworth Country Fair in memory of pilot Jon Egging whose Hawk jet crashed on August 20 during a performance at Bournemouth. The team flew in the famous diamond formation leaving a space where Jon Egging would have flown. (Photo by Christopher Furlong/Getty Images)
